After Easter Mass all people get together to play “COCCINO” this is an Easter tradition... here how it works:

  • every people put a coloured hard –boiled egg into a line
  • all people form a circle
  • the game leader distributes one egg each
  • the first people knock with his egg on rival egg….
  • the winner is the egg undamaged …
  • the winner wins the broken egg and carry on his work with an other rival egg….
